What Is a Professional CV?

Curriculum vitae is the description of an individual’s qualifications, education, achievements, skills, and experiences in his/her life. It is used by employers to see whether an individual is fit for a particular position.

A professional CV should be:

  • Readable
  • Grammar error free
  • Neatly formatted
  • Up-to-date
  • Attractive

Step-by-Step Guide How to Create a Professional CV

Step 1: Include Contact Information

Start your CV with accurate contact details.

Include:

  • Full Name
  • Mobile Number
  • Professional Email Address
  • City and Country
  • LinkedIn Profile
  • Portfolio Website

Step 2: Write a Strong Professional Summary

A professional summary is a short introduction at the top of your CV.

Example

“A motivated individual with comprehensive understanding of cybersecurity, networking, and software development looking for new opportunities where I can utilize my technical abilities for organizational success.”

Keep it:

  • Short
  • Relevant
  • Achievement-focused
  • 3-5 lines long

Step 3: Highlight Your Work Experience

List your work experience in reverse chronological order.

Include:

  • Job Title
  • Company Name
  • Employment Dates
  • Key Responsibilities
  • Achievements

Example

SOC Analyst Intern
ABC Security Solutions
January 2025 – June 2025

  • Monitored security alerts and incidents.
  • Conducted vulnerability assessments.
  • Assisted in threat detection and response.
  • Improved incident response documentation.

Best CV Formatting Tips

A professional-looking CV should have:

Use Simple Fonts

  • Calibri
  • Arial
  • Times New Roman

Font Size

  • Headings: 14–16
  • Body Text: 10–12

Keep Consistent Formatting

  • Uniform spacing
  • Proper alignment
  • Consistent bullet points

Save as PDF

Always submit your CV in PDF format unless instructed otherwise.

FAQs

1. What makes a CV look professional?

A professional resume is clear, organized, and readable. It should have accurate data, a neat format, proper skills and experience related to the position you are targeting.

2. Can I create a professional CV without any work experience?

Yes, definitely. As a student or a fresh graduate, concentrate on your educational background, internships, volunteer activities, certificates, projects, skills, and so on. Any employer knows that one must start somewhere.

3. How often should I update my CV?

It is advisable to regularly revise your resume every few months if you acquire new skills, certificates, jobs or achievements. This will save your time in the future.

4. Is it okay to use a CV template?

Yes, creating your resume according to a professional template may be useful. Just try not to make it complicated and distracting.
